In this review of the WHITIN Little/Big Kid Wide High Top Barefoot Shoes the bottom line is clear: these are for parents who want a natural, roomy shoe that supports healthy foot development without fuss. The single strap and elasticated laces make them simple to put on and take off, while the wide toe-box and zero-drop design prioritize natural movement. Reviewers repeatedly note comfort, durability, and cute street-style looks, so families seeking an everyday barefoot-style sneaker for active children will find strong value here.
Key Features
- Wide toe-box: Provides roomy toe freedom so little feet can splay and develop naturally during play.
- Zero-drop design: Ergonomic zero-drop sole encourages balanced, natural gait and easy movement for young walkers.
- Single strap and elastic laces: Combine for a secure fit that is also quick and easy for kids and parents to manage.
- Re-enforced toe caps: Durable, water-resistant overlays protect toes and extend the shoes life through outdoor wear.
- High-top collar: Supportive channel-quilted collar gives an old-school street silhouette while helping ankle stability.
Who It's For
These barefoot sneakers are best for parents who prioritize natural foot development, flexible soles, and a roomy toe area for toddlers and growing kids. The easy on/off closure suits busy families who want a practical daily shoe that still looks stylish.
They may be less suitable for parents who need heavy winter insulation or rigid orthotic support; for those cases a lined boot or medical shoe would be a better option. Also, families expecting heavy-duty hiking use should choose a more technical, stiff-soled shoe.
